WebApiClient icon indicating copy to clipboard operation
WebApiClient copied to clipboard

请问 HttpApiClient.Create<T>() 还支持吗?

Open shiyl962 opened this issue 1 year ago • 1 comments

如题,需要如文章:1.1 最简单的Get请求#

public interface MyWebApi : IDisposable { // GET http://www.mywebapi.com/webapi/user?account=laojiu [HttpGet("http://www.mywebapi.com/webapi/user")] ITask GetUserByAccountAsync(string account); }

var myWebApi = HttpApiClient.Create<MyWebApi>(); var userStr = await myWebApi.GetUserByAccountAsync("laojiu"); myWebApi.Dispose();

来调用此库,但找不到 HttpApiClient.Create<T>() ,请问 HttpApiClient.Create<T>() 还支持吗? 盼复,谢谢!

shiyl962 avatar Sep 05 '23 02:09 shiyl962

你好,WebApiClientCore仅支持依赖注入环境下使用,老版本WebApiClient.Jit支持这种形式的使用,详情参考文档 https://webapiclient.github.io 新老版本文档都包含

EzrealJ avatar Sep 07 '23 17:09 EzrealJ